预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于内容的发布订阅系统中事件快速匹配算法研究的中期报告 中期报告: 1.研究背景 随着互联网技术的快速发展,人们在获取信息的过程中越来越依赖于内容发布订阅系统。在这种系统中,发布者定期或不定期地发布新的事件,订阅者将自己感兴趣的事件进行订阅,并在事件发生时接收到相关信息。然而,在这种系统中,一个事件的发布需要同时通知大量的订阅者,而订阅者订阅的事件也可能非常多,这就给后台的事件匹配带来了很大的挑战。 2.研究目的 本研究旨在研究一种基于内容的发布订阅系统中,用于快速匹配事件的算法。该算法能够高效地将事件与订阅者进行匹配,同时保证事件的发布不会极大地消耗服务器资源。 3.研究内容 针对该研究目的,我们进行了如下的研究内容: (1)综述了当前内容发布订阅系统的状况,分析了其中存在的问题和挑战。 (2)对事件和订阅者的相关属性进行了整理和分析,确定了用于匹配的重要属性。 (3)设计了一种基于倒排索引的匹配算法,并采用了局部敏感哈希(LSH)来实现高效的匹配。 (4)通过实验对该算法进行了验证和评测,证明了其在匹配效率和准确性上的优势。 4.下一步工作 在接下来的工作中,我们将进一步完善基于内容的发布订阅系统中事件快速匹配算法。具体工作包括: (1)进一步分析订阅者和事件的相关属性,确定用于匹配的重要因素。 (2)探究更优秀的局部敏感哈希(LSH)算法,提升匹配效率。 (3)对算法进行更充分的测试和评估,从多角度评估算法的性能。 (4)结合实际应用场景对算法进行优化和改进,提高算法的实用价值和适用性。 5.结论 本研究在基于内容的发布订阅系统中事件快速匹配算法的研究中,在综述了问题和挑战后,采用了倒排索引和局部敏感哈希(LSH)算法,设计出了一种高效的匹配算法。本文对该算法进行了实验验证,证明了其在匹配效率和准确性上的优势,并提出了下一步完善的工作计划。